The Palhinha Puzzle: A Domino Effect on Gravenberch’s Transfer
Liverpool supporters have been on tenterhooks regarding the club’s pursuit of Bayern Munich’s Ryan Gravenberch. The uncertainty arose after Bayern’s planned acquisition of Fulham’s Joao Palhinha hit a snag. However, Gravenberch himself seems to consider the move to Anfield a done deal.
The Anfield Assurance: Liverpool’s Confidence in Sealing the Deal
Contrary to the swirling rumours, Liverpool remain steadfast in their belief that Gravenberch’s transfer is on track. The Merseyside club is confident that all essential paperwork has been finalised, and a mutual agreement has been reached with Bayern Munich.
The Klopp Conundrum: Liverpool’s Midfield Makeover
The departure of Fabinho and Jordan Henderson to Saudi Arabia earlier this summer left a void in Liverpool’s midfield. Jurgen Klopp’s side acted swiftly, bringing in Wataru Endo to bolster their defensive midfield options. Now, with a £34.2 million price tag, the 21-year-old Gravenberch is poised to be the latest addition to Liverpool’s evolving midfield.
The New Blood: Liverpool’s Youthful Midfield Reinforcements
Liverpool’s midfield has undergone a significant transformation since last season. Following the arrivals of Endo, Dominik Szoboszlai, and Alexis Mac Allister, the Reds are keen to inject more youthful energy into their squad. Gravenberch, a product of Ajax’s renowned youth academy, fits the bill perfectly.
The Gravenberch Profile: A Versatile Midfield Maestro
Gravenberch is not a newcomer to the European football stage. The Dutch midfielder has a proven track record, particularly during his time at Ajax. Known for his mobility and proficiency in the no.8 role, he is expected to slot seamlessly into Klopp’s favoured 4-3-3 formation. Despite a less-than-stellar stint at Bayern Munich, his previous success at Ajax—where he notched up 12 goals and 13 assists in 103 appearances—speaks volumes about his potential.
